☝🏼IMPORTANT NOTE: To ensure the automation rule works when the Checklists custom field is hidden from the work item screen, some additional configuration is required. Please follow these steps to set up the work item layout:

  1. Navigate to Jira Settings → Work items → Custom fields.

  2. Find the Checklists custom field in the list.

  3. Click the 3-dots menu → Associate to Screens.

  4. Select the checkboxes for the screen(s) under the project you want to use automation rule.

  5. Click Update.

  6. Go to Project settings → Work items → Layout.

  7. Click Edit issue layout.

  8. Move Checklists custom field from the central panel to the right panel.

  9. Click Save changes.

Steps to create Automation

  1. Go to Project Settings → Automation → click Create rule

  1. Create a trigger

2.1. Choose Work item created 

2.2. Click Next

  1. Add sub-tasks to the Issue

3.1. Add component: Add an action

3.2. Choose Create sub-tasks

3.3. List subtasks you need

  1. Add Checklist to the sub-tasks

4.1. Click Add fields - your subtask will be converted to a separate action step

4.2. Choose Same Project to be sure the sub-task is not lost

4.3. Add Checklists custom field from Choose fields to set

4.4. Add Checklist Items using checklist Markup formatting or Checklist Template

4.5. Click Next

  1. Name your new Automation and Turn it on

 

You're done! Now every time an Issue is created new sub-tasks with Checklist Items will be created automatically 🎉
